Tin siding installation involves attaching durable metal panels to the exterior of a building to provide a protective and visually appealing surface. This service typically includes preparing the existing structure, measuring and cutting panels to fit, and securely fastening them to ensure long-lasting coverage. Skilled contractors will also handle any necessary sealing around edges and corners to prevent water infiltration, helping to improve the overall durability of the property’s exterior.

This type of siding is often chosen to address common issues such as rotting, warping, or pest damage that can occur with traditional wood or vinyl siding. It also offers a solution for properties that need a more weather-resistant exterior, especially in areas prone to heavy rain, high humidity, or temperature fluctuations. Tin siding can serve as an effective barrier against the elements, reducing maintenance needs and protecting the underlying structure from moisture-related problems.

Properties that typically use tin siding include residential homes, especially those seeking a vintage or industrial aesthetic, as well as commercial buildings that require robust exterior cladding. It is also popular for outbuildings, barns, and sheds where durability and low maintenance are priorities. The overview below groups typical Tin Siding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Aiken, SC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or tin siding repairs in Aiken and surrounding areas range from $250 to $600. Many routine patch or replacement j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and material costs.

Full Siding Replacement - Replacing entire sections of tin siding can usually cost between $2,000 and $5,000 for most residential projects. Larger or more complex installations, such as multi-story buildings, may push costs higher but are less common.

Custom or Specialty Installations - Custom tin siding projects, including decorative or specialty finishes, often range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. These projects tend to be less frequent and involve unique design features or materials.

Large Commercial Projects - Larger commercial or industrial tin siding jobs can start at $10,000 and may exceed $20,000 depending on size and scope. Such projects are less typical for residential clients but are handled by local contractors for larger-scale need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ing contractors for Tin Siding Install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of successfully completing tin siding jobs in the Aiken, SC area or nearby communities. Asking about past projects can provide insight into their familiarity with the specific requirements and challenges of tin siding, ensuring that the chosen contractor has the skills necessary to deliver quality results. A contractor’s history with comparable work can be a strong indicator of their ability to meet expectations and handle the unique aspects of the project.

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ors for tin siding installation. Homeowners should seek detailed proposals that out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and the estimated process involved.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. It’s also beneficial to clarify any questions about the process upfront, ensuring that both parties share a common understanding of what the job entails. This transparency can contribute to a smoother experience and better overall results.

Reputable references and effective communication are key factors in selecting a reliable service provider. Homeowners are encouraged to ask for references from previous clients who have had similar work completed. Speaking with past customers can reveal insights into the contractor’s professionalism, reliability, and quality of work. Additionally, a contractor’s responsiveness and willingness to answer questions can indicate how well they communicate and prioritize customer satisfaction.
